var Gun = require('./index');
Gun.Mesh = require('./mesh');
// TODO: resync upon reconnect online/offline
//window.ononline = window.onoffline = function(){ console.log('online?', navigator.onLine) }
Gun.on('opt', function(root){
this.to.next(root);
if(root.once){ return }
var opt = root.opt;
if(false === opt.WebSocket){ return }
var env = Gun.window || {};
var websocket = opt.WebSocket || env.WebSocket || env.webkitWebSocket || env.mozWebSocket;
if(!websocket){ return }
opt.WebSocket = websocket;
var mesh = opt.mesh = opt.mesh || Gun.Mesh(root);
var wire = mesh.wire || opt.wire;
mesh.wire = opt.wire = open;
function open(peer){ try{
if(!peer || !peer.url){ return wire && wire(peer) }
var url = peer.url.replace(/^http/, 'ws');
var wire = peer.wire = new opt.WebSocket(url);
wire.onclose = function(){
reconnect(peer);
opt.mesh.bye(peer);
};
wire.onerror = function(err){
reconnect(peer);
};
wire.onopen = function(){
opt.mesh.hi(peer);
}
wire.onmessage = function(msg){
if(!msg){ return }
opt.mesh.hear(msg.data || msg, peer);
};
return wire;
}catch(e){ opt.mesh.bye(peer) }}
setTimeout(function(){ !opt.super && root.on('out', {dam:'hi'}) },1); // it can take a while to open a socket, so maybe no longer lazy load for perf reasons?
var wait = 2 * 999;
function reconnect(peer){
clearTimeout(peer.defer);
if(!opt.peers[peer.url]){ return }
if(doc && peer.retry <= 0){ return }
peer.retry = (peer.retry || opt.retry+1 || 60) - ((-peer.tried + (peer.tried = +new Date) < wait*4)?1:0);
peer.defer = setTimeout(function to(){
if(doc && doc.hidden){ return setTimeout(to,wait) }
open(peer);
}, wait);
}
var doc = (''+u !== typeof document) && document;
});
var noop = function(){}, u;
